Eid-el-fitr: Bauchi Islamic NGO trains members on traffic management

In preparation for the celebration of Eid-el-fitr, a Bauchi State-based non-governmental organisation, known as the Wunti Al-Khair Foundation has given training to members of joint Islamic Aid Organisation on basic and technical skills on crowd and traffic management, emergency response to ensure orderliness and free-flow of traffic during the festive period in the state.

Leadership reported that the volunteers’ two-day training held at the Bauchi Central Mosque Jama’atul Nasril Islam on Sunday, was sponsored by the foundation chairman and indigene of Bauchi Local Government Area, Alhaji Bala Wunti.

The Director of National Aid Group of Jama’atu Nasril Islam Alhaji Bala Ibrahim Sani, while speaking at the training, explained that the foundation chairman have over the years sponsored such Islamic promotional activities by giving volunteers the prerequisites to perform their duties.

Sani, while noting that the training is the fifth of its kind being sponsored by Bala Wunti, said, “We lack words to express our gratitude to the founder of the foundation other than pray for bountiful rewards from Allah”.

According to Sani who is also the Lifidin Bauchi, the foundation trained 150 Islamic Aids members who can also step it down to other volunteers to ensure the forthcoming Eid-el-Fitr celebration is smooth, orderly and accident-free.

Lifidin Bauchi expressed optimism that the trained volunteers would assist corps of the Federal Road Safety Commission , the Red Cross operatives and other sister/voluntary organisations for a peaceful Ei-del-fitr celebration.

He also expressed to the foundation leader the need for some ambulance vehicles for essential medical services during such voluntary activities.

The foundation chairman, who is regarded as philanthropic and patriotic indigene of the state, Alhaji Bala Wunti said that the training of the ‘Yan Agaji is focused on the conduct and celebration of Eid-el-fitr by the Muslims Ummah slated for next week.

Wunti, who is a group general manager, National Petroleum Investment Management Services, affirmed that his commitment to the foundation’s determination to ensure that the thousands of Muslim faithful attending various Eid Grounds are properly guided gave birth to the exercise.
